3. DINAGYANG (Learner 3)
Is a Religious and cultural festival in
Ilo-Ilo City, Philippines held on the
fourth Sunday of January. It held
both to honor the Sto. Nino and to
celebrate the arrival on Panay of
Malay settler and the subsequent
selling of the island to the by altis.
4. SINULOG (Learner 4)
The FAMOUS FESTIVAL in Cebu
City, is held in every year on the third
Sunday of January. The festival is
characterize by a very long parade
dressed in colorful costumes, finding
their way through the streets while
dancing Siulog.
6. PAHIYAS (Learner 6)
One of the country’s biggest and
most colorful harvest festival every
15th of May, along the harvest
festival of the towns of Tayabas,
Sariaya, Gumaca and Tiaong. This
Festival known as Harvest festival to
honor San Isidro Labrador, the
patron saint of farmers knows
“PAHIYAS”.
